New recruits asked to deliver quality banking services

 RAJSHAHI, April 27, 2018 (BSS) – Senior bankers have asked their newly recruited subordinates to show their professional skills in discharging their duties.

They came up with the call while addressing the closing and certificate- giving session of a five-day orientation course for 32 newly appointed supervisors of Rajshahi Krishi Unnayan Bank (RAKUB) at its training institute here on Thursday.

RAKUB Managing Director Kazi Alamgir and its General Manager Mozammel Haque, among others, spoke on the occasion with principal of the institute Ataur Rahman in the chair.

The speakers stressed for ensuring client-friendly banking so that the clients get benefits of the banking services.

Highlighting the importance of RAKUB in agricultural development of the northwest Bangladesh, they said the bank officers should apply the knowledge acquired from the training course in their professional field properly to help boost agricultural production in the region.

As the largest development partner in the agricultural sector of the northwest Bangladesh, RAKUB plays a vital role in achieving economic emancipation of people through boosting credit-flow to the potential agricultural fields.
